Compare all specifications:

1997 Porsche 993 1989 Volvo 740
Make Porsche Volvo
Model 993 740
Year Released 1997 1989
Engine Position Rear Front
Engine Size 3589 cc 2315 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type boxer in-line
Horse Power 282 HP 155 HP
Torque 341 Nm 203 Nm
Drive Type 4WD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 2 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1420 kg 1372 kg
Vehicle Length 4250 mm 4790 mm
Vehicle Width 1800 mm 1760 mm
Vehicle Height 1290 mm 1420 mm
Wheelbase Size 2280 mm 2780 mm
